Laparoscopic vs. open biliopancreatic diversion with duodenal switch: a comparative study

Summary
Laparoscopic biliopancreatic diversion with duodenal switch (BPD-DS) offers effective weight loss comparable to open surgery in superobese patients. However, both methods carry significant risks, necessitating further research for optimal bariatric treatment.
Area of Science:
- Bariatric Surgery
- Minimally Invasive Procedures
- Obesity Management
Background:
- Biliopancreatic diversion with duodenal switch (BPD-DS) is an effective bariatric procedure for long-term weight loss.
- Superobesity (BMI >60) presents unique surgical challenges.
Purpose of the Study:
- To compare the safety and efficacy of laparoscopic BPD-DS versus open BPD-DS in superobese patients.
- To evaluate outcomes in terms of morbidity, mortality, and comorbidity improvement.
Main Methods:
- Retrospective study of 54 superobese patients (BMI >60) from July 1999 to June 2001.
- 26 patients underwent laparoscopic BPD-DS, and 28 underwent open BPD-DS.
- Comparison using unpaired t test.
Main Results:
- Major morbidity rates were similar: 23% (laparoscopic) vs. 17% (open), P = 0.63.
- Mortality rates were also similar: 7.6% (laparoscopic) vs. 3.5% (open), P = 0.51.
- Significant improvement in preoperative comorbidity was observed in 8 laparoscopic patients versus 2 open patients (P < 0.02).
Conclusions:
- Laparoscopic BPD-DS is technically feasible and achieves weight loss comparable to the open approach.
- Both laparoscopic and open BPD-DS are associated with considerable morbidity and mortality in superobese patients.
- Further studies are required to establish the optimal surgical treatment for superobesity.
